摘 要:根据黄河中下游降雨洪水泥沙特性,采用成因分析法、数理统计法、模糊聚类法、分形分析法、圆形分布法等多种方法,对黄河中下游主要洪水来源区和控制站降雨、洪水、泥沙影响因子进行了分期点识别。结果表明:黄河中下游汛期洪水泥沙不仅在时间上有较明显的多分期特点,而且在空间上也有显著的分期时间差异。经综合分析,确定潼关、花园口站汛期洪水分期点为9月10日、10月10日,三门峡—花园口区间汛期洪水分期点为8月20日、10月10日。According to the characteristics of rainfall,flood and sediment in the middle-lower Yellow River,flood season staged in the main sources of flood supply and control station was studied with multi-method,such as causes analysis method,mathematical statistics method,fuzzy set analysis method,fractal analysis method,circle distribution method and the influence factors included rainfall,flood and sediment.The results show that there is an obviously flood,sediment multi-stage temporal and spatial characteristics in the middle and lower Yellow River. Through comprehensive analysis,it determines that the flood season staged points of Tongguan and Huayuankou stations are September10 and October 10 respectively; and the flood season staged points of Sanmenxia-Huayuankou reach are August 20 and October 10 respectively.
